Answer:

  c.  {x | x ≠ 4/5}

Step-by-step explanation:

Given:

  • f(x) = (x -3)/x
  • g(x) = 5x -4

Find:

  The domain of (f ◦ g)(x)

Solution:

The domain of f(x) excludes the value of x that makes the denominator zero. That is, it is all real numbers except x = 0.

Then the domain of f(g(x)) must exclude any value of x that makes g(x) be zero. That value would be ...

  g(x) = 0 = 5x -4

  4 = 5x . . . . . . . . . . add 4

  4/5 = x . . . . . . . . . .divide by 5

The domain of (f ◦ g)(x) is all real numbers except x = 4/5. In set notation, it could be written ...

  {x | x ≠ 4/5}
